Our Unattended Death Cleanup Process

From first call to final walkthrough, here is what to expect from All Trauma Scene Cleanup in Columbia Heights, DC.

1

Compassionate Response & Assessment

We arrive quickly with compassion and professionalism. Our team assesses the decomposition stage, biological contamination spread, structural damage, and odor severity to plan the complete remediation.

2

Biological Hazard & Material Removal

Our Columbia Heights technicians remove all biological contamination and compromised structural materials using full PPE and containment protocols. Every contaminated item is sealed in biohazard containers for proper disposal.

3

Deep Decontamination & Odor Elimination

All Trauma Scene Cleanup uses a multi-step decontamination and odor elimination process at your Columbia Heights, DC property. Hospital-grade disinfectants, enzyme treatments, and industrial odor technology ensure the space is safe and odor-free.

4

Structural Restoration

We replace subfloor, drywall, insulation, flooring, and trim — restoring the property to a condition where no evidence of the event remains. Insurance coordination is included throughout.

How much does unattended death cleanup cost in Columbia Heights, DC?

Unattended death cleanup in Columbia Heights typically ranges from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the stage of decomposition, affected area, materials requiring removal, and odor severity. Advanced decomposition with structural penetration costs more due to extensive material removal. All Trauma Scene Cleanup provides free assessments with detailed estimates.

What if the death was not discovered for weeks in Columbia Heights?

Extended unattended deaths require more extensive cleanup including removal of flooring, subfloor, drywall, and sometimes framing. Decomposition fluids penetrate deeply over time. Who is responsible for cleanup after an unattended death in Columbia Heights?

The property owner or their representative is typically responsible for cleanup after an unattended death in Columbia Heights. For rental properties, the landlord bears responsibility.
